Prerequisite

Combat Focus (PH2) , WIS 13, any two other combat form feats, base attack bonus +15,

If you choose to end your combat focus as a swift action, you gain a bonus on attack rolls and damage rolls equal to your total number of combat form feats for the rest of your current turn. You immediately lose all BENEFITS: of combat form feats that affect you only while you are maintaining your combat focus.

A fighter can select Combat Strike as one of his fighter bonus feats.
